Polymer bathrooms, shower trays, as well as other acrylic restroom ware have actually ended up being much more usual in bathrooms in recent times. Not as durable and also sophisticated as enamel and also porcelain bathrooms and fixtures, they are more economical and serve pretty a lot the very same fundamental purpose. Some typical examples of damage to acrylic restroom components include staining, cracks, holes, and so on.Bathroom Discoloration
With prolonged use acrylic bathrooms comes staining or staining. While some discolorations can be removed conveniently, using special chemicals, others call for that the bathroom be resprayed. It is essential to keep in mind that bleach or detergents do extremely little in getting rid of such staining and they may even aggravate it. A lot of times, these cleansing agents cause discoloration with time. Aromatherapy oils loosen up the dirt in many cases therefore bring back the bath to its previous glory. Cleaning up and also polishing likewise occasionally. For even more stubborn discolorations, you will need a brand-new layer of coating. This kind of dealing with will certainly require a specialist.Chain reaction
Sometimes, people try to repaint the whole surface area of their acrylic bathroom on their own either because they do not such as the shade to hide acnes. Nevertheless, when they do not such as the outcome, they apply paint eliminators. You should never make use of paint remover on acrylic baths. Although paint cleaners do not respond with the surface area of steel bathrooms, they ruin acrylic bathrooms irreversibly. This produces even more work for the specialist. The best strategy right here is to call a professional for help with changing the bathroom.Damaged shower or bath surface area
Acrylic restroom fixtures are not abrasion-resistant like enamel varieties. They are more susceptible to scratches and also less resilient. Being a really soft product, acrylic scrapes can even be concealed without finishing or filling. For these, you must look for professional aid for your bath repair work. As a prevention idea, prevent making use of rough sponges when cleaning. Instead, you ought to utilize an easy fluid cleaner with a soft pad.Split Polymer Baths
The life-span of acrylic as well as fiberglass bathrooms is up to 15-20 years for shower frying pans as well as baths, usually. Cracks in an acrylic shower tray are probably among the most convenient troubles to fix for a repair expert. This is the exact same for PVC, material, as well as various other such materials.
